Information on the Target
Peters Geotekniska Borrningar AB, founded in 2006 and based in Lund, Sweden, specializes in geotechnical drilling services. The company generates an annual revenue of approximately 20 million SEK and employs six staff members. With a strong foothold in environmental and geotechnical drilling, Peters Geotekniska Borrningar has established itself as a leader in the industry by offering a broad range of services, including various environmental drilling and installation of pipes.
As part of its expansion, the company now joins VA Gruppen, allowing it to enhance its growth opportunities, decrease administrative burdens, and provide greater development prospects for its employees. The current CEO and seller, Peter Hylander, will continue in his role and reinvest a significant portion of the purchase price into VA Nordic AB, the holding company of VA Gruppen.

The Rationale Behind the Deal
The acquisition of Peters Geotekniska Borrningar AB by VA Gruppen aligns with the latter's strategic intent to enhance its offerings in the geotechnical sector. With this move, VA Gruppen aims to solidify its position as Sweden's most expertise-driven water and wastewater company. The integration of Peters Geotekniska Borrningar allows for expanded service capabilities, especially in the realm of remediation tasks, which are expected to grow substantially.
Moreover, this acquisition allows VA Gruppen to benefit from Peters' established market presence and expertise while providing the latter with the resources and collaborative environment to scale and diversify their operations further.
Information about the Investor
VA Gruppen was founded in 1977 and has evolved to focus on water and wastewater services, including other management and construction projects. The company's reputation is built on a commitment to transparency and quality-driven processes, earning them the trust of numerous clients and municipalities throughout Skåne.
As VA Gruppen seeks to broaden its expertise, the acquisition of specialists like Peters Geotekniska Borrningar fits perfectly into their vision of becoming the leading player in the geotechnical sector. They are committed to providing robust and comprehensive services to address the water management needs of the region effectively.
